Only First Power Unit Assignment Check is Performed All Others are Ignored (Doc ID 1930164.1)

Last updated on JULY 20, 2024

Applies to:

Oracle Transportation Management - Version 6.3.4 to 6.3.5 [Release 6.3]
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

When Driver Assignment process is triggered and Show Option is clicked, the system is only evaluating the first power unit assignment check (special service/remark) when the group of drivers is evaluated.
Therefore, if the first driver power unit assignment check failed, all the other drivers power unit assignment checks also failed because system is evaluating only first driver power unit for all the drivers instead of evaluating their corresponding one.

The issue can be reproduced at will with the following steps:


1. Create 2 drivers and set them as active. First of them has the qualifier with the value 'N' and the second has the value 'Y'.
2. De-activate all the other drivers.
3. Go to Actions, Assign, Driver, Show Options

None of the two drivers are assigned.
